Understanding Glass CondensationWhat is Glass Condensation?
Condensation on glass occurs when warm, wet air enters into contact with a cooler surface. As the warm air cools, it loses its capability to hold moisture and the water vapor condenses into liquid droplets on the glass. This phenomenon is specifically typical in double-glazed windows, where moisture can end up being caught in between the panes.
Reasons For Glass CondensationTemperature Differences: When the inside air is warmer than the outdoors air, condensation is most likely to form on the glass surface areas.High Humidity Levels: During seasons of high humidity, such as summertime, the moisture material in the air increases, leading to more condensation opportunities on Glass Condensation Repair surface areas.Poor Ventilation: Inadequate air flow can trap humid air in enclosed areas, increasing the possibility of condensation.Faulty Seals in Double-Glazing Units: If the seals in double-glazed windows fail, moisture can go into the airspace between the panes, leading to condensation issues.Results of Glass CondensationIncreased Energy Costs: Condensation can result in thermal inefficiency, causing homes to lose heat during cold weather.Mold Growth: Moist environments foster the development of mold and mildew, presenting health risks.Structural Damage: Prolonged moisture can damage window frames and cause rot.Approaches for Glass Condensation Repair
Repairing glass condensation mainly depends on the source of the problem. Here are numerous strategies to consider:
1. Improving Ventilation
Description: Enhancing airflow within a room assists reduce humidity levels.

Steps:
Open windows to permit fresh air to circulate.Usage exhaust fans in kitchens and bathrooms to expel damp air.Consider setting up a whole-house ventilation system.2. Utilizing Dehumidifiers
Description: A dehumidifier can effectively reduce indoor humidity, helping to remove condensation.

Pros:
Highly reliable in damp environments.Adjustable settings for various rooms.3. Repairing or Replacing Window Seals
Description: If double-glazed windows are fogged up, the seals may be jeopardized. Repairing or changing these seals can prevent moisture from going into.

Steps:
Remove the existing sealant.Tidy the relevant surfaces.Use a replacement seal or think about a professional repair.4. Window Treatments
Description: Using window treatments can assist insulate your windows.

Types:
Thermal drapes: These can help keep warm air in and cool air out.Window film: This can help in reducing heat transfer.5. Glass Replacement
Description: If condensation persists and indicates a bigger problem, replacing the glass system may be needed.

Indications that replacement is required:

Preventing glass condensation is frequently more efficient than fixing it post-formation. Here are several techniques to reduce the possibility of condensation on glass surfaces:
Maintain Indoor Temperature: Keep indoor temperature levels constant to minimize the event of condensation.Use Humidity Monitoring: Install hygrometers to track humidity levels inside your home. Aim for a humidity level below 60%.Insulate Windows: Use insulated window units to limit thermal distinctions between inside and outside.Seal Leaks: Regularly look for leakages in window frames and walls
